I did this last Tuesday and it was brilliant - heading back again with lydiadrabkinreiter this coming week. It was pretty well attended with six ladies in the beginners group and around 15 in the experienced group. The coaches were friendly and great teachers - first we practised bike handling skills and cornering off the track and then moved onto the track, gradually building up from doing one jump to half laps and then a full lap of the track. I loved trying out a new cycling discipline in a safe and supportive environment, and was really pleased with how quickly I picked it up. The sessions are part of the BMXercise initiative - women's only BMX sessions which run all across London, more details on the Facebook page here: www.facebook.com/BMXerciseLondonbmxuk/?fref=tsNo need to book - but if you want to, you can by calling the number in my post above. Helmet, bike and gloves are all provided, you just need to turn up wearing long sleeves and trousers. It will be free for the next few weeks, after that the sessions continue but cost around £5/session. Although the coaches will teach complete beginners, some of the ladies in the more experienced group had clearly been riding BMX for quite a while and were still able to gain something from the session. I second all of Esther's comments about the BMX sessions - they're huge fun, and very different from riding on the road (hardly any pedalling, and more upper body work - so good cross-training!) Though bike-handling skills transfer, so you definitely have an edge over complete beginners. Last free week next week - come along!
